Output 87b78fa79b42943d4f1fbefe8c2a068b5641335aafca56a0c3ef27b9dcee53d7:1

value
12620450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44c86af56b46287c51d42798b7e64940c3dc324 OP_EQUAL
address
3M3YrLdpE3dVqKwgyU4rcxDz9nDZWQRiKa
transaction
87b78fa79b42943d4f1fbefe8c2a068b5641335aafca56a0c3ef27b9dcee53d7
confirmations
485295
spent
true